The Next Phase: Exploring Innovation in Clinical Trials
Business & Economics Podcasts
The clinical research industry is changing at a rapid pace, and with good reason. Considering the gaps and issues exposed by the COVID-19 crisis, successful sites, sponsors and CROs recognize that it’s time for The Next Phase with a move toward a new, nimbler era of clinical research. Hosted by the remote site monitoring experts from Florence Healthcare, this podcast explores the new tools and practices that will better allow us to advance human health today and beyond.
